
Adorg C Gel
Marketer
Medcure Organics Pvt Ltd
Salt Composition
Adapalene (0.1% w/w) + Clindamycin (1% w/w)
Overview Adorg C Gel
DermaClear Gel combines two active ingredients for effective acne treatment. This formulation reduces sebum production and combats inflammation, eliminating acne-causing bacteria and preventing secondary infection. This helps clear pimples, blackheads, and whiteheads. DermaClear Gel is for topical use only, applied as directed by your physician. Cleanse and dry the affected area before applying a thin layer. Avoid application to broken skin and contact with eyes, nose, or mouth; rinse immediately if contact occurs. Visible improvement may take weeks; consistent use is crucial; discontinue only as advised by your doctor. Minor temporary side effects, such as itching, burning, redness, or oiliness, may occur, usually resolving spontaneously. Persistent or bothersome side effects warrant medical consultation. Inform your physician of any gastrointestinal issues or concurrent skin medication use. Pregnant or breastfeeding individuals should consult their doctor before using this product.

Common Side effects of Adorg C Gel:
- Skin peeling
- Erythema (skin redness)
- Itching
- Dry skin
- Burning sensation at the site of application

How Adorg C Gel works:
Adorg C Gel combines Adapalene and Clindamycin to effectively manage acne. Adapalene, a retinoid (vitamin A derivative), regulates sebum production, unclogs pores, and promotes skin cell turnover. Clindamycin, an antibiotic, targets and eliminates acne-causing bacteria within the skin.

P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Using Adorg C Gel during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scarce, animal studies indicate potential harm to the fetus. A physician will assess the advantages against possible risks prior to prescribing it. Seek medical advice.
Breast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The use of Adorg C Gel while breastfeeding appears to pose minimal risk. Available human data indicates insignificant danger to the infant.

What if you forget to take Adorg C Gel :
Should you forget a dose of Adorg C Gel, apply it promptly.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ed application and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id applying a double dose.
